Location and Neighborhood Analysis

Expert insight on Hilton Head Island real estate:

Premier Neighborhoods and Their Signature Traits

  1. Sea Pines: Often referred to as the pinnacle of opulence on Hilton Head Island, Sea Pines epitomizes luxury living. Expansive estates with views that stretch across impeccably groomed golf courses and private pathways leading to secluded beaches define this elite enclave—a true sanctuary for those desiring peace amidst nature’s beauty.
  2. Palmetto Dunes: A paradise for active families and sports aficionados, Palmetto Dunes presents a lively community vibe coupled with access to top-tier golf courses, tennis courts, and expansive lagoon systems perfect for water adventures like kayaking or canoeing.
  3. Shipyard Plantation: For those seeking solitude without sacrificing amenities, Shipyard offers an understated yet amenity-rich environment with direct beach access, premier golf facilities, and scenic bike paths winding through dense maritime forests.
  4. Forest Beach: Dubbed as Hilton Head’s “downtown,” Forest Beach thrives with proximity to local boutiques at Coligny Plaza Shopping Center alongside bustling nightlife—ideal for those who revel in energetic surroundings.
  5. Bluffton: Positioned just beyond the island but still within the heart’s reach of Hilton Head culture lies Bluffton—a picturesque town rich in Southern charm featuring both modern developments and meticulously restored historic homes.

Decoding Property Taxes and Additional Ownership Costs

Property taxes are an unavoidable aspect of property ownership here and differ markedly across various parts of Hilton Head Island. Generally assessed as a percentage of your property’s appraised value, these taxes contribute to local services that boost both living quality and property worth. Moreover, if your chosen home falls within a managed community boasting amenities such as pools or tennis courts, be prepared for homeowners association (HOA) fees.

Maintenance expenses also demand consideration—particularly vital in coastal areas where salt air intensifies wear and tear. Anticipate costs for periodic maintenance like painting, roof upkeep, and garden landscaping which are essential in safeguarding the value of your investment.

Navigating the Buying Process

Mastering the real estate acquisition journey in Hilton Head Island:

  1. Tailoring Your Search: The journey kicks off by identifying your lifestyle needs and financial comfort zone, which sharpens our focus during the search. Whether you’re drawn to a charming oceanfront condominium or an expansive luxury estate with stunning golf course views, we’ll arrange private tours to explore these properties’ unique features up close.
  2. The Critical Role of Home Inspections: A comprehensive home inspection is indispensable. It uncovers potential hidden issues—from foundational concerns to aging HVAC systems—that could otherwise go unnoticed. Being aware of these factors early can prevent costly surprises later on, safeguarding your investment.
  3. Appraisals: Protecting Your Investment: Appraisals are crucial for confirming that the property’s market value matches your investment level—essential for securing mortgage approval from lenders who need assurance that they’re not over-lending compared to the property’s actual worth.
